Transaction c883d765cb9d98aa86b7622bb528848eb88e0360e856051a9114c46574e31c6c
2 Input
1 Outputs
- c883d765cb9d98aa86b7622bb528848eb88e0360e856051a9114c46574e31c6c:0
value 36257238
address 15dooriEixRSUCErbjPjm2ES8udvinVrSN